Legislative Reception and Business After Hours at the Endicott Estate-Dedham

The Neponset Valley Chamber of Commerce is pleased to announce the Legislative Reception at the Endicott Estate
in Dedham.

Members of the Chamber and business people from the Neponset Valley are invited to join us on Thursday, June 21, 2012 from 5:30-7:30pm.

Local and state elected and appointed officials from the region have been invited to come meet the local business community.  The legislative reception is an opportunity to facilitate dialogue between our local and state leaders and
the business community in order to create a better understanding of the issues
that impact business.

“Business people often feel that their voice is not heard at town hall or on Beacon Hill.  At the same time, local and state officials say that they want to hear from the business community.  This meeting allows both groups to get
together in a relaxed setting to discuss their respective agenda’s in person,” said Chamber president, Tom O’Rourke.

There is no formal speaking program, instead participants will be able to mix, mingle, and NETWORK with one another while enjoying complimentary hors
d'oeuvres, beer, wine and refreshments.
